abapGit/src/zif_abapgit_environment.intf.abap
Marc Bernard e42e502d7d
Add support pack to debug info (#4779)
* Add support pack to debug info

* Add get_basis_release

* Lint

* Structure

Co-authored-by: Lars Hvam <larshp@hotmail.com>
2021-05-20 11:30:05 +02:00

31 lines
777 B
ABAP

INTERFACE zif_abapgit_environment
PUBLIC.
TYPES:
BEGIN OF ty_release_sp,
release TYPE c LENGTH 10,
sp TYPE c LENGTH 10,
END OF ty_release_sp.
METHODS is_sap_cloud_platform
RETURNING
VALUE(rv_result) TYPE abap_bool.
METHODS is_merged
RETURNING
VALUE(rv_result) TYPE abap_bool.
METHODS is_repo_object_changes_allowed
RETURNING
VALUE(rv_result) TYPE abap_bool.
METHODS compare_with_inactive
RETURNING
VALUE(rv_result) TYPE abap_bool.
METHODS is_restart_required
RETURNING
VALUE(rv_result) TYPE abap_bool.
METHODS is_sap_object_allowed
RETURNING
VALUE(rv_allowed) TYPE abap_bool.
METHODS get_basis_release
RETURNING
VALUE(rs_result) TYPE ty_release_sp.
ENDINTERFACE.